For example, on DoorDash, dashers can receive ‘contract violations‘ when a customer complains about issues that were potentially the driver’s fault. Dashers can be deactivated from the platform after too many contract violations. Dashers can receive a contract violation for a late delivery, a missing delivery, or even missing items.. This year, DoorDash took the lead and now has the largest market share, with about 27.6% consumer spend of the food delivery market, according to a report from Edison Trends. GrubHub trails slightly behind at 26.7%, Uber Eats with 25.2%, and Postmates – which confidentially filed for an IPO in February – holds a little more than 12% of the ... Uber - you have a pretty large margin for pickup time an delivery. More organized with their order system, most of the time orders are ready. Doordash - Most of the time you get the request right when the order is placed, so many times the orders aren’t ready when you arrive. The pickup/deliver by times are ridiculous.With DashPass, subscribers pay a monthly fee of $9.99 and receive free delivery on orders over $15. For orders that don’t meet the $15 threshold, there is a delivery fee of $1.99. There is also a service fee, which is variable but generally ranges from 10-18%.
